Transaction e363d55ac158dab62a4fe34132ae2e1f7cce7041743b4bd494a506397a3358f0
1 Input
1 Output
-
e363d55ac158dab62a4fe34132ae2e1f7cce7041743b4bd494a506397a3358f0:0
- value
- 44615371
- script pubkey
- OP_0 OP_PUSHBYTES_20 636e98498ab7f65f91b18bf434e27142bd7610ff
- address
- bc1qvdhfsjv2klm9lyd3306rfcn3g27hvy8lq6eg8e